More about the book
Focusing on the intersection of ethics and scientific practice, Bernard Rollin critiques the prevailing ideology that dismisses ethical considerations in science. He introduces fundamental ethical concepts and addresses critical issues such as human and animal research, genetic engineering, and cloning, highlighting their societal implications. Through insightful analysis, he advocates for integrating ethics education into scientific training, emphasizing its importance for the advancement of both science and society.
